Limit breaks are special moves that characters can perform under
special situation, for example when they are low on HP. Some causes
massive damage while some can boast the party's power. For the
japanese version, limit break is known as special or special arts
in Final Fantasy VIII.
Basic Requirement:
1)Present HP is at or below 32% of max HP.
=>Applies to ALL CHARACTER, except SEIFER.
=>Seifer's HP must be at or below 84% of max HP.
2)Aura Condition.
3)Special Condition (Refer to b and c)
When either one or both conditions are satisfied, a > mark will appear
randomly on the right side of the "Attack" command. Hold right while
pointing the cursor at the "Attack" command. Then choose the limit
break(s) you want to use.
Note:When in curse condition, the > mark will never appear, meaning
you won't get a chance to use any limit break(s).
Aura
====
Aura is a magical spell when cast on a character allows him to use
limit breaks even though his HP is not very low. When in Aura
condition, you will notice your characters turn golden yellow
colour. Aura allows your character to use limit breaks temporarily
and how long Aura condition last, depends on your Crisis level. The
higher your Crisis level is , the longer the time your character will
be in Aura condition. You can also use item, Aura Stone during battle.
How to get Aura spells?
=======================
You can get it by drawing Aura spells when fighting with Seifer in
disc 3 at Lunatic Pandora. You can also draw Aura spells from draw
points found in Island Of Hell or Island Of Heaven. Simply equip
Siren's Move/Find and Encounter None and walk in the island(s).
Island of Hell is found in the western part of Galbadia, which is
that long stretch of coast in the most northwest part of the
world map. You can find Island of Heaven in the northeast part of
the world map, just north of the Grandidi forest where chocobo
Holy is.
Crisis Level
============
Each character has an internal perimeter known as the crisis level,
which works like a gauge bar in Final Fantasy VII. It affects the
chances of using a limit break. As crisis level increases, chances
of using limit break increases. Below shows the various ways of
increasing your crisis level:
a)HP is decreased.
b)Negative Status Condition.
c)Party member(S) is dead.
________________________________
|Negative Status Bonus|Crisis(Up)|
|_____________________|__________|
|Slow | + 6% |
|_____________________|__________|
|Petrify | + 12% | The table on the left
|_____________________|__________| shows how much your
|Blind | + 12% | Crisis level will
|_____________________|__________| increase if your
|Poison | + 12% | characters are in any
|_____________________|__________| of the negative status.
|Silence | + 12% |
|_____________________|__________|
|Death Sentence | + 18% | Refer to below for
|_____________________|__________| more explanation on
|1 Party Member down | + 8% | how this negative status
|_____________________|__________| bonus works.
|2 Party Member down | + 16% |
|_____________________|__________|
So, in the example of character with Poison and Death Sentence, one
party member down, and HP at 32%, the value is (32 (basic value) + 12
+ 18 + 8 )= 70% chance of > appearing.
Acquiring New Limit Breaks
==========================
Different characters have different ways of acquiring limit breaks.
It can be through reading magazines; upgrading to a more powerful
weapon, or even finding certain items. The details of how each
character acquire his limit breaks will be covered individually
at each character's section.

V)Organ
=======================================================================
Ever wonder what the organ in Ultimecia Castle is used for? Well,
nothing much but it can lead you to a rare item, Rosetta Stone.
This is what you should do:
Go to the organ and choose to play the organ. Press L1, R1, L2, R2,
Circle, Square, X, Triangle simulaneously. Now, exit to return back
to the courtyard and take the passage to the right. You will notice
that the hole in the wall to the right is now opened. Enter and
it will lead you to another new area. Walk through the passage
and at the next screen, search the top-right corner of the
screen for a Rosetta Stone.

VI)Report Cards
=======================================================================
So, what's a report card? Well, it just a summary of your current
progress in the game. There are a total of 3 battle reports, naming
Battle, Character and Guardian Force reports. You can view these
reports via the tutorial menu. So, how do you get it?
Battle Report
=====================
When Squall has promoted to a SeeD in disc 1, talk to Cid Krammer in
the Headmaster Office in 3F of Balamb Garden to receive Battle
Report. Note that this can be done only in disc one.
Character Report
=====================
When you are in Desert Prison in disc 2, head to floor 10, enter the
door and you should see a card player and a save point. [And a hidden
draw point as well.] Challenge the player there and when you win,
he will give you the Character Report. This can be done only in disc
two. Note that each card game you play with him costs 300 Gil.
Guardian Force Report
=====================
After returning back to Balamb Garden from Desert Prison and has
beaten Master Norg, go to the Training Center [Training Centre]
and CC Joker will occasionally appear there. Note that chances
of CC Joker appearing there are random. He appears as a merchant,
selling items. Talk to CC Joker and play cards with him. Once
you defeat him, you will get the Guardian Force Report.

Many years back, Square was on the verge of closing down. They
needed a game that would really sell. They saw Enix's Dragon
Quest and the sales were a big phenomenon in Japan. For your
information, Yuji Hori did the script for Dragon Quest and
Akira Toriyama [Fame and Creator of Dragon Ball!] did all the
artworks. Creator of Final Fantasy, Hironobu Sakaguchi had an
intuition. Why not create something like Enix's Dragon Quest
and improve the basic formula of the game? "Will the game
sell?" his boss asked. Hironobu Sakaguchi replied, "Yes!"
Together with Yoshitaka Amano, responsible for Final Fantasy
artworks, and Nobuo Uematsu, the famous composer, began work
on this so-called 'Final' game and if this 'Final' game wasn't
a hit, Square is finished. The 'final' game was then known as
'Final Fantasy.' Luckily, the first Final Fantasy managed to
sell quite well, though sales in Japan didn't exceed that of
Dragon Quest but it managed to keep Square alive.
